Description
This is the second of two tracks for the Halloween Jam Spooktacular by Jack Hemby (davisamerica) and Joseph Gurner (jgurner) and featuring guest vocals by Alannah.
From Jack:
Joe's backing track arrived fully constructed kicking backsides and taking names.
While surfing the net for some new "spooky sounds" to possibly use I ran across a site that carried the alleged "news story" about a drilling crew in Siberia who "drilled into hell" and captured the sounds of tormented souls. An Urban Legend right? When Joe and I filtered the "recording" we discovered the sound was just a poorly recorded Alannah jamming with some Dead Heads. The Lady gets around.
Be forewarned the last few seconds are those mysterious "sounds" the crew picked up.
Sleep tight.
From Joe:
This one was fun because I got to channel my inner Dave Vanian and The Damned. Plus, I had to figure learn how to effectively play a C minor chord.
Again, I sent the basic track to Jack and he fleshed it out, adding some great keyboards along the way.
And I have to tell you, Alannah gets downright scary on this one, so be warned.
Lyrics and vocals - Joe
Backing vocals - Alannah
Guitars and bass - Joe
Keyboards, ambient sounds and maniacal laugh - Jack
